Transaction 21793553fe2291760e8be8077d51124567243c76b3acaa24401b10ac380a8758
1 Input
1 Output
-
21793553fe2291760e8be8077d51124567243c76b3acaa24401b10ac380a8758:0
- value
- 129529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eed3f8c53df7e055aa09be1fe060a6463c50f499 OP_EQUAL
- address
- 3PTpgFmcChy1YP2qfqSjpSkDTvoVdAv8np